Damage to the Door

There are many issues that may occur to double-glazed doors over time. Some are very minor and do not affect the performance of the window while others can cause serious issues. It is important to call a professional immediately if the damage is caused either by weather, wear and tears or improper handling.

Clouding or fogging is a frequent issue between the glass panes of double-glazed units. This is caused by moisture gets into the dead space between the glass panes. It could also be caused by fluctuations in temperature, which causes the gas inside to expand and expand and contract.

Contacting a professional to get rid of the condensation between the glass panes is a good solution to this issue. This will restore a clear view and prevent energy loss. Repairs for a double glazed door will vary based on the nature and severity of damage and the difficulty of the work needed. The glass on the front of the door is the most costly to replace because of the wear and tear placed on this part. It could be anything from balls and https://lolipop-pandahouse.ssl-lolipop.jp/ toys that are thrown, to lawnmowers who kick up rocks. The cost of back door glass replacement is less costly, as the door is rarely used and is not subject to the same amount of abuse as the front one.

Replacement-Windows-150x150.jpgAnother common repair is the need to replace misted or cloudy double glazing. This is typically caused by moisture in between the panes, which can cause condensation. A company that specializes in UPVC repair can fix this at a reasonable cost. Some companies even offer to make holes in the misted window to help draw moisture out however this isn't an option that is permanent and will only work for a period of about six months.

Maintenance

The most frequent issue with double glazing that buyers complain about after purchasing it is doors and windows becoming difficult to open and close. This is typically caused by extreme weather conditions. It can be resolved by wiping the mechanism clean with cold water or oiling it. If this does not work, it's worth contacting the company from which you bought the double glazing. Certain companies offer a guarantee of 10 or even 20 years. Others offer lifetime guarantees.
